WASHINGTON , DC – The Gypsum Association announces the 2006 release of its flagship publication, GA-600, Fire Resistance Design Manual (FRDM).
The 162-page, 18th edition of the FRDM depicts over 340 systems that may be used for fire-rated walls and partitions, floor-ceiling systems, roof-ceiling systems, and to protect columns, beams, and girders. Included for the first time in this edition are several new floor- and roof-ceiling systems and double-stud steel partition designs.
This manual provides contractors, designers, specifiers, owners, and others with a convenient compilation of the latest in tested gypsum-board designed fire-rated protection systems (as well as some tried and true older systems that have been with us for quite awhile). It also helps building officials keep up with fire-rated gypsum board systems that are permitted under the codes.
